winform中的用户控件精讲
时间: 2024-09-09 13:10:27 浏览: 45
简介Winform中创建用户控件
WinForm中的用户控件(User Control)是一种自定义控件,它允许开发者将多个界面元素组合在一起,形成一个可重用的单元。用户控件可以包含文本框、按钮、标签等标准控件,并可以实现更复杂的交互逻辑。在WinForm应用程序中,用户控件被设计为具有以下特点:
1. 封装性:用户控件封装了一组相关的功能,可以在不同的表单中重复使用,提高开发效率。
2. 可定制性:用户控件可以包含属性和方法,允许在设计时和运行时进行设置和交互。
3. 继承性:用户控件可以继承自现有的控件类,也可以被其他控件或表单继承。
创建用户控件的基本步骤如下:
1. 在Visual Studio中,选择创建新的项目,并在项目类型中选择用户控件库(Windows Forms Control Library)。
2. 编辑用户控件的设计视图,添加所需的控件元素。
3. 在用户控件的代码文件中编写业务逻辑代码。
4. 编译用户控件项目,生成dll文件。
5. 在其他WinForm项目中,通过工具箱将用户控件添加到表单上,并进行必要的设置。
使用用户控件时,可以在工具箱的“常用控件”下拉列表中找到并拖拽到表单上。之后,开发者可以通过属性窗口设置控件属性,并通过编程方式控制其行为。
阅读全文